The average bus between Causeway Bay (Water) and Ngong Ping takes 2h 3m and the fastest bus takes 1h 47m. There is a bus service every few hours from Causeway Bay (Water) to Ngong Ping.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Buses run hourly between Causeway Bay (Water) and Ngong Ping. The earliest departure is at 7:01 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Causeway Bay (Water) is at 5:34 PM which arrives into Ngong Ping at 7:58 PM. All services require a transfer at Tung Chung Crescent and take an average of 2h 3m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ct bus from Causeway Bay (Water) to Ngong Ping. However, there are services departing from Causeway Bay (Water) station and arriving at Ngong Ping station via Tung Chung Crescent.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 3m.
Causeway Bay (Water) to Ngong Ping bus services, operated by Citybus, depart from Tin Lok Lane station.
Causeway Bay (Water) to Ngong Ping bus services, operated by Citybus, arrive at [Nlb] Ngong Ping Village station.
The distance between Causeway Bay (Water) and Ngong Ping is 28.6 km. The road distance is 60 km.
You can take a bus from Tin Lok Lane to [Nlb] Ngong Ping Village via Tung Chung Crescent and Tung Chung Tat Tung Road Bus Terminus in around 2h 16m.
